Read more– opens a dialog boxEach review score is between 1 and 10. To get the overall score you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of them. We use a weighted review system, which means the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. Guests can also give separate “subscores” in crucial areas like location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value, and free Wifi. Note that guests submit their subscores and over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.
You can review an accommodation that you booked through our platform if you stayed there, or if you got to the property but didn’t actually stay there. To edit a review you’ve already submitted, contact our Customer Service team.
We have people and automated systems that specialize in detecting fake reviews submitted to our platform. If we find any, we delete them and, if necessary, take action against whoever is responsible.
Anyone who spots something suspicious can always report it to our Customer Service team so that our fraud team can investigate.

Min
Singapore+No power outlets on the counter/table +A little hard to get to without a car, but at least it's pretty close to a bus stop
+Great view right outside the room +Dinner prepared by the host was really good, there were local dishes made using local ingredients (NTD500 per person) +The host organizes firefly viewing trips together with nearby BNBs (NTD200 per person), where they provide transport to and fro a protected firefly area. Highly recommend participating because there's really nothing else to do in the area.

Hui
SingaporeRoom is clean and breakfast is provided. Water kettle,hair dryer, shampoo is 3 in for body and hair and hair conditioner is provided. Toliet is clean with towels provided. Bed and pillows is clean and comfy. Owner is very nice and friendly. Dinner is provided upon request with a charge of 500 twd per person. Has to inform the owner 1 days before as she will need time to prep. Dinner is fixed menu by the owner, they used vegetables from their own garden. Dinner consist of 5 dishes with 1 soup. View is superb, fresh air and quiet environment. There is no lift, 2 levels in this air bnb. Most of the double beds are on the 2nd floor of the property and the tatami style bedroom is at level 1. Has a small hike downhill with cherry blossoms trees as well. There is no 711 nearby. Has to travel down by car. Fenqihu is just 10mins away by car, need to be there early to walk around as shops are mostly closed by 5pm in the evening. Will stay here again if i am coming to alishan. ^^

Sebastian
SingaporeWe didn't know there was a bus stop just outside the B&B. This bus stop is unmarked on maps and only known to locals. So we dropped off in town and climbed the very steep hill with our luggages to check in.
Breakfast was delicious. The place is near some of the quieter trails and made for very good morning walks. The place overlooks tea plantations and is quiet restful. The sunset was gorgeous as the place is high enough to be able to see the sea of clouds in the evening. Host went out of the way to drop us off in town for lunch, and gave excellent directions to trails and to take the bus back to Chiayi.
